Food Protection Management Training Program for Food Service Managers This 2-day course, presented by the Texas Agricultural Extension Service in cooperation with the National Restaurant Association, the Texas Department of Health (TDH), and TPCA, satisfies TDH requirements for certified food service manager training. Attendees receive the ServSafe program materials from the Educational Foundation of the National Restaurant Association. This material instructs managers on [1] sanitation and hygiene, [2] food flow with HACCP (hazard analysis critical control points), and [3] facilities and equipment regulations.HAZMAT Certification Training Offered by TPCA associate member, Linscot Enterprises, this program satisfies the Federal Department of Transportation requirements of HM126F and HM 232 (HAZMAT Transportation Security). This certification requires renewal every three years and applies to all employees involved with or responsible for the transportation of hazardous materials such as gasoline and diesel. Certification is required for warehouse workers and dispatchers in addition to transport drivers. Training is offered at various locations around the state throughout the year. TPCA/LJT Seller Server Training School This program is certified by the Texas Alcoholic Beverage Commission and is widely used throughout the state. It is designed for retailers who do not have timely access to training facilities or schools for the training and certification of newly hired employees. With this computer-based training program and Internet testing, employees can be training and certified virtually before they spend time behind the counter. An employer’s representative is the administrator of this self-study program dealing only with TPCA for material, LJT Management for technical support and Bennett & Associates for certification.TPCA/LJT Tobacco Seller Certification Training This program is certified by the Texas Comptroller of Public Accounts.
